With my new eye I was eventually able to concentrate my skills on a specific technique.The technique that allows me to highlight and capture natures finest details is called 'casting'. Casting is a lengthily process that allows you to turn a real leaf you picked off a tree, make a mold of it, and then turn it into a beautiful silver leaf. Most of my work is casted from things in nature or at least has a component of a casted nature piece. So far I have casted many leaves, which you can see with my pendants, branches, flower pods, berries, rose buds and more to come!
